Krempachy
Krempachy is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Nowy Targ, within Nowy Targ County, Lesser Poland Voivodeship, in southern Poland. It is one of the 14 villages in the Polish part of the historical region of Spiš.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Dursztyn is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Nowy Targ, within Nowy Targ County, Lesser Poland Voivodeship, in southern Poland. It is one of the 14 villages in the Polish part of the historical region of Spiš. Dursztyn is situated 3 km southeast of Krempachy.

Trybsz is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Łapsze Niżne, within Nowy Targ County, Lesser Poland Voivodeship, in southern Poland, close to the border with Slovakia. Trybsz is situated 3½ km southwest of Krempachy.
